AI Summary

  • School boards must require schools to provide daily supervised, unstructured, child-directed play for all students in kindergarten through grade 8.

  • Daily play time must total at least 60 minutes, with individual play periods lasting at least 15 consecutive minutes, and cannot include computers, tablets, phones, or videos.

  • Schools are encouraged but not required to hold play time outdoors, and play time may include both unstructured play and organized games.

  • Play time cannot be withheld as a disciplinary or punitive action, and does not count toward physical education requirements or vice versa.

  • Play time counts as clock hours toward instructional time requirements, effective July 1, 2020.
